Output 6609aaecab59fbf4f61a7174b040fcaf4b0010a0233e44fc565c604c2e0fa17e:5

value
226260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e3ad8f1dba679572002d45f061a5885e5120d1 OP_EQUAL
address
3AhttgiCQwKMa9i9KLcnm7QevU3DMeUCEb
transaction
6609aaecab59fbf4f61a7174b040fcaf4b0010a0233e44fc565c604c2e0fa17e
spent
true